An instructive therapeutic magical tale about the goodness that exists within each of us

Many years ago, in a small town on the very shore of the sea, there lived a man. The doors of his house were always open, because he was very kind and always helped people. His eyes sparkled like reflections on water, and when he began to speak, his voice was calming and incredibly mesmerising.

Since ancient times, people came to this man for various kinds of help. Some asked him to look into the future and tell them what the harvest would be like in the coming year. Others sought his help in dealing with illness. Everyone believed that this man possessed supernatural abilities, thanks to which all the people of this town were happy. The man always came to everyone's aid, so they called him — the Sorcerer.

No one in the town knew how old this Sorcerer was. His eyes were lively and young, his hair was completely grey, and his gaze was calm, deep and wise.

Every day he opened the doors of his house to those who needed help. And the Sorcerer could hear things that others could not. The grey-haired man easily conversed with birds in their own language, understood animals and was friends with trees and flowers. By looking at the sky and speaking mysterious magical words, the Sorcerer could predict rain, snow or storms.

Everyone in town knew of the Sorcerer's existence, but where he came from and how old he was — that was a mystery of mysteries. Many said that once he had been an ordinary man. Just like all the other inhabitants of this town. But then something happened, and he gained a wonderful gift of magic. Now the Sorcerer lived alone on the shore of the sea, and his calling was to help all who needed it, to make the people of the seaside town happy.

In many homes, in the evenings, children would ask their parents about the Sorcerer's fate. They were so curious about where he got such incredible abilities and how he controlled them. After all, it was real magic — true sorcery!

One day, people from a neighbouring town learned of the Sorcerer and wanted to lure the wizard to them. Here everyone was gloomy, angry and discontented, the sun in their town shone very rarely, and smiles on faces could only be seen when someone was in trouble.

And so one day these angry and discontented people set out after the Sorcerer. They burst into the joyful town and began to beat, destroy and break everything around them.

Where does your Sorcerer live?

They cried, breaking down the doors of every house.

We will take him from you, and he will obey our orders.

At that moment, the Sorcerer sensed something was wrong. He went to the shore of the sea, looked at the sky and whispered something.

At that very moment, someone called out to him:

Sorcerer, help! Terrible things are happening in the town! Some people want you to go with them and do whatever they wish!

Do not be afraid, we will deal with everything together!

The man replied calmly.

But how? You are the only one with magic! Only you can protect us from all these troubles and these evil people.

The frightened townspeople asked doubtfully.

Listen to me carefully, and try to grasp the essence of what I am about to tell you!

The Sorcerer said calmly.

Magic is within each of you! I want each of you to close your eyes for a moment and listen to yourself.

The people followed the Sorcerer's advice. Each of them closed their eyes, took a deep breath and felt that the earth was breathing with them.

This is an incredible feeling!

One of the people exclaimed.

I can hear the sounds of nature. I can hear the sea whispering that it will help us overcome all hardships and will protect our town from evil people at all costs. I can hear the wind rustling, and it seems to be tuning my inner world towards goodness.

Then the other people who had come to the Sorcerer for help joined in.

The Sorcerer looked at those around him and said:

Now you know what magic is. I have passed on my knowledge to you, and now you will be able to overcome all difficulties. Magic is not only the ability to recognise the sounds of nature, but also the ability to hear its rhythm, and the rhythm of your own heart. Only in harmony with yourself and nature will you be able to move mountains and live in goodness and happiness.

The people thanked the Sorcerer and went home. It was already getting dark, and they all needed to return home. Upon returning to town, they suddenly saw that the evil people had disappeared.

The next day, the townspeople went to the Sorcerer again to tell him what had happened and to delight him with the news that the town was no longer in danger.

But when they came to the shore of the sea, they saw only a lonely tree in place of the house, which rustled its leaves quietly and seemed to be trying to say something. The people came closer, closed their eyes and listened again to the rhythm of nature.

Now you know how to help yourself and others, how to live in harmony and goodness.

Each of them heard the Sorcerer's voice within themselves.

From that day on, the man never appeared in those parts again. And the townspeople completely forgot about the existence of the evil people.

Now they could hear each other, listen to their inner voice. The townspeople began to recognise the sounds and desires of nature, they were surrounded by harmony, goodness and peace.

It turns out that magic exists within each of us, and we ourselves are the true creators of a happy and peaceful life!
